It could be, use this look up tool if the serial number is on the left dropout (near the rear axle). The sprocket isn't Schwinn though, but for 60 bucks, it looks like you made out well.

http://schwinncruisers.com/serial-number.html
 
What did the thing say the year was? If it is off, there are other ways of figuring it out.
 
It looks like original paint on the fenders, they repainted the rest from the looks of it. The rims look like they were painted silver, are they chrome or white underneath? Assuming it is an original bike, that would help ID the model. There are only a couple straight bar framed bikes those years, so it shouldn't be too difficult. The name may still be on the chain guard under the repaint. No holes for a headlight on the front fender either. Possibly a standard Schwinn, D-12, although it has the smaller chain guard, it looks closest to your bike.
